What is PASSIVATED


In electronic components, passivated refers to a treatment applied to protect the surface of the component.

This treatment is important to increase the durability and reliability of the part.

Generally, in electronic components, passivation protects the component from external factors by creating a film on the metal surface of the component.

This process is performed to protect components from chemical effects such as oxidation, corrosion and chemicals.

In particular, passivation is particularly important in semiconductor parts.

Since minute defects on the surface of semiconductor components act electrically sensitively, the passivation process is essential to ensure durability and stability of components.

Generally, passivation is applied using silicone and organic materials to the surface of the part.

These materials are effective in protecting the surface of parts and increasing the durability of parts.
